- [ ] **Step 7: Breaker override escrow.** After sealing the signing keys for the Tallgrove upstream API circuit breaker, confirm the support team can force the breaker open during a full outage. The override bundle lives in the sealed escrow drawer and is useless without its unlock phrase. Two ceremony witnesses must initial this step before proceeding. The escrow bundle is decrypted with the recovery passphrase that follows.

vault phrase of kahip-kahop = holath-quenmir

Team assistants — the key cabinet for the pool cars has moved to the alcove behind the front desk at Marlowe Court. Sign keys out and in on the clipboard every time, no exceptions. Return keys by 18:00 or the car gets flagged as missing. The cabinet locks automatically. To open it, punch in the code below.

door code, fawep-hawep: bdg-C-22

Hey plugin folks—if your export job dies mid-run and the normal retry API won't take it, you've probably hit the poisoned-job quarantine. Don't loop retries; that just fills the dead-letter queue. Instead, use break-glass access: it bypasses quarantine once, logs everything, and pings the Driftmere ops channel automatically. Use it sparingly—every invocation gets reviewed at Friday triage, and repeat offenders lose the privilege. Ready? To open the break-glass console, enter the emergency passphrase below.

vault phrase of bafof-kahap = quenix-casok